We’re looking for Senior Product Manager to be part of a PM team leading platform innovations across Xbox Console, PC, Cloud, and Windows. You will define the product strategy and orchestrate execution across engineering, design, and partner teams. From vision to launch, you’ll drive alignment, velocity, and impact.
Responsibilities
- Developing Technical Product Strategies: Identify customer needs, analyzing trends, combining your technical expertise with your product knowledge, and develop product roadmaps that align with Xbox’s vision and strategy
- Execute on Product Development: Write clear and concise product specifications, user stories, and acceptance criteria for new and existing features. Additionally, conducting internal testing, A/B testing, and analyze production data to validate hypotheses and measure the impact of features
- Thinking Creatively and Driving Innovation: Think creatively and deliver on new ideas, constantly striving to improve and innovate. Identify new product opportunities and developing innovative solutions that meet the needs of our customers and business
- Delivering High-quality Results: Meet customer needs and schedule while ensuring that our products meet the highest standards of quality and reliability
- Collaborating with Cross-functional Teams: Work collaboratively with others across organizations to achieve success
- Clear Communication: Communicate the product vision, value proposition, and roadmaps to internal and external teams to gaming, including senior leadership

Product Management IC4 - The typical base pay range for this role across the U.S. is USD $119,800 - $234,700 per year. There is a different range applicable to specific work locations, within the San Francisco Bay area and New York City metropolitan area, and the base pay range for this role in those locations is USD $158,400 - $258,000 per year.
